There was also a demolition derby in GTA: Vice City, but I think it's more likely it was one of the DD games as above. I think there was a PS2 version of the DD games, I could be wrong though. DD2 was my favourite, the first two were made by Reflections, the creators of Driver and Stuntman.

The game in the OP is Destruction Derby Raw (the third game in the series, which was completely lost in the hype train for the PS2 launch). There was also Demolition Racer, which came out about a year earlier on PSX and PC (and a year later on DC) and looked like this:
